Indeed this is a revelation from the Lord of the Universe; 192 brought down by the Faithful Spirit 193 To (communicate) to your heart that you may be a warner 194 In plain Arabic language. 195 And verily, it (the Quran, and its revelation to Prophet Muhammad SAW) is (announced) in the Scriptures [i.e. the Taurat (Torah) and the Injeel (Gospel)] of former people. 196 Is not the fact (that the Israelite scholars already knew about the Quran through their Book) sufficient evidence for the pagans of the truthfulness (of the Quran)? 197 And if We had revealed it (this Quran) unto any of the non-Arabs, 198 And he had recited it to them, and they had not believed (it would have been different). 199 Thus it passes through the hearts of the criminals. 200 They will not believe therein until they behold the torment afflictive. 201 It shall come to them of a sudden, while they perceive it not; 202 They will therefore say, “Will we get some respite?” 203 Seek haste then they with our torment? 204 Just think: If We let them enjoy (the good things of life) for a few years more, 205 and then the chastisement of which they were being warned were to come upon them, 206 So of what benefit will be the comforts that they were using? 207 And We did not destroy any city except that it had warners 208 and reminded: for, never do We wrong [anyone]. 209 And the devils have not brought the revelation down. 210 It is not meet for them, nor is it in their power, 211 indeed they are debarred from overhearing it. 212 So call not upon another god with Allah, lest you be of those who are punished. 213 Warn your nearest kinsmen, 214 And lower thy wing to the Believers who follow thee. 215 And if they disobey thee, say thou: verily I am quit of that which ye work. 216 Put your trust in the Almighty, the Most Merciful, 217 Who observes you when you rise (to pray) 218 or move during your prostration with the worshippers. 219 He is the All Hearing, the All Knowing. 220 Shall I tell you on whom the satans descend? 221 They descend upon all sinful self-deceivers 222 They give ear, but most of them are liars. 223 And the Poets,- It is those straying in Evil, who follow them: 224 Have you not seen them wandering and bewildered in every valley 225 and they say what they do not do? 226 Except those [poets] who believe and do righteous deeds and remember Allah often and defend [the Muslims] after they were wronged. And those who have wronged are going to know to what [kind of] return they will be returned. 227
God the Almighty always says the truth.
End of Surah: The Poets (Alshu'araa'). Sent down in Mecca after The Inevitable (Al-Waaqe'ah) before The Ant (Al-Naml)
